Trade Nation Overview for Bhutan

Trade Nation is a UK-headquartered forex and CFD broker founded in 2014, with a global presence and a growing reputation for transparent pricing and user-friendly platforms. For Bhutanese retail forex traders, Trade Nation presents an interesting option due to its $0 minimum deposit, which lowers the barrier to entry significantly. The broker offers a range of instruments including major and minor forex pairs, indices, commodities, and cryptocurrencies, all traded with competitive spreads and no commission on standard accounts. While Trade Nation is not directly regulated in Bhutan, it operates under several international licenses, including the FCA (UK), ASIC (Australia), FSCA (South Africa), and SCB (Bahamas). This multi-regulatory framework provides a degree of oversight, though Bhutanese traders should understand that their accounts may fall under the less protected jurisdictions. The broker’s emphasis on educational resources and a clean, intuitive trading interface makes it a good fit for both beginners and experienced traders in Bhutan. However, the absence of the popular MetaTrader platforms and a swap-free Islamic account may limit its appeal for some. Overall, Trade Nation is a credible, low-cost broker that can serve Bhutanese traders well, provided they are comfortable with its platform and regulatory setup.

Common Mistakes Bhutan Traders Make with Trade Nation

  • Mistake: Assuming FCA regulation fully protects Bhutanese clients — always check which entity you are trading under, as Bhutanese accounts are often held under the SCB or FSCA, which offer less protection.
  • Not verifying deposit fees — while Trade Nation doesn't charge deposit fees, your Bhutanese bank or Skrill may impose charges for international transfers or currency conversion; always check before funding.
  • Expecting MT4/MT5 compatibility — Bhutanese traders who rely on automated trading or Expert Advisors should not choose Trade Nation, as it does not support these platforms.
  • Overlooking the lack of an Islamic account — Muslim traders in Bhutan must seek alternative brokers if they require swap-free accounts, as Trade Nation does not offer this option.
